I won't write-off Tamim so easily. From what I have seen of him so far, his footwork is actually better than that of Javed Omar or Shahriar Nafees - you don't see him fishing outside the offstump or getting rapped on the pad as often happen to the other two guys. This can be an important factor when the team will be in NZ this December, where pitches probably won't offer much bounce but lots of swing and seam movement.

As I said before, Tamim has his limitations (not being able to pull or hook) and needs to work on them. For now, he needs to stop playing all those weird shots while facing short deliveries.
